2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, there is known a cooking device with a steam generation function that generates steam during cooking and performs cooking (see, for example, Patent Document 1).
As shown in FIG. 5, such a heating cooker 100 with a steam generation function is a heating cooker that supplies steam to the heating chamber 101 that houses the object to be heated M and heats the object to be heated. A steam generation unit 103 that generates steam in the heating chamber 101, a circulation fan 104 that stirs and circulates the air in the heating chamber 101, and a convection heater as an indoor air heater that heats the air that circulates in the heating chamber 101 105 and an infrared sensor 106 that detects the temperature in the heating chamber 101 through a detection hole provided in the wall surface of the heating chamber 101.

By the way, in the heating cooker with a steam generation function as described above, the steam is supplied from the steam generation section to the heating chamber to perform the heat treatment, so that condensed water is generated at the door member and the partition plate. Condensed water generated on the door member flows down along the front surface of the housing as the door member opens and closes, and is collected in a tray provided below the front portion of the housing. On the other hand, the dew condensation water generated on the partition plate flows down through the partition plate and is stored and naturally dried.
However, when a large amount of steam is used for cooking, or when cooking is frequently performed using steam, the natural drying of stored condensed water may not catch up. For this reason, the cooking device with the steam generation function which can collect | recover the dew condensation water especially generate | occur | produced on the partition plate reliably was calculated | required.

従って、仕切板12の裏面に発生した結露水Wは、仕切板12を伝って滴下し、受水部材30に受けられる。受水部材30では、受けた結露水Wを筐体19の左右両外側に導水し、受水部材30の両端部から滴下する。受水部材30の両端部の下方には縦樋部材31が設けられており、受水部材30からの結露水Wを受けて所定位置に滴下させる。縦樋部材31の下方には横樋部材32が設けられており、縦樋部材31からの結露水Wを筐体19の前方に導水して、結露回収トレー20の貯溜部材33に滴下・貯溜する。貯溜されている結露水Wは、結露回収トレー20を筐体19から取り外して排水する。   Therefore, the dew condensation water W generated on the rear surface of the partition plate 12 drops along the partition plate 12 and is received by the water receiving member 30. In the water receiving member 30, the received dew condensation water W is guided to the left and right outer sides of the housing 19 and dropped from both ends of the water receiving member 30. A vertical rod member 31 is provided below both ends of the water receiving member 30, and the condensed water W from the water receiving member 30 is received and dropped at a predetermined position. A horizontal rod member 32 is provided below the vertical rod member 31, and the dew condensation water W from the vertical rod member 31 is guided to the front of the housing 19 and dripped and stored in the storage member 33 of the dew condensation collection tray 20. . The stored condensed water W is drained by removing the condensation collection tray 20 from the housing 19.

以上説明したように、本発明に係る蒸気発生機能付き加熱調理器10によれば、仕切板12で発生した結露水Wを、筐体19の前部の結露水回収トレー20に回収することができ、容易に排水することができる。このため、蒸気を多く使用する調理や頻繁に調理を行う場合でも、確実に結露水Wを回収することができる。また、横樋部材32および貯溜部材33は筐体19に着脱可能に設けられているので、容易に清掃することができ、清潔に保つことができる。   As described above, according to the heating cooker 10 with a steam generation function according to the present invention, the dew condensation water W generated in the partition plate 12 can be collected in the dew condensation water collection tray 20 at the front portion of the housing 19. Can be easily drained. For this reason, even when cooking using a lot of steam or when cooking frequently, the condensed water W can be reliably recovered. Moreover, since the recumbent member 32 and the storage member 33 are detachably provided on the housing 19, they can be easily cleaned and kept clean.

なお、以上の説明では、受水部材30の幅方向中央部を高くして、筐体19の幅方向外側に向かって下降するように設けた場合について説明したが、その他、受水部材30の幅方向中央部を最も低くして、両端部を高くすることも可能である。この場合には、受水部材30に滴下した仕切板12からの結露水Wは、全て一旦中央部に集められて回収し、排水することになる。   In addition, in the above description, although the case where it provided so that the center part of the width direction of the water receiving member 30 was made high and it descend | falls toward the width direction outer side of the housing | casing 19 was demonstrated, It is also possible to make the center part in the width direction the lowest and make both ends higher. In this case, all the condensed water W from the partition plate 12 dropped on the water receiving member 30 is once collected in the central portion, collected, and drained.
